Only 323 cases produced.This is cool-climate vineyard in the Russian River that was first made famous by John Wetlaufer and Helen Turley and subsequently by Landmark Vineyards. The Chasseur 2010 Lorenzo displays exquisite peach, honeyed citrus, orange rind and lemon oil notes with hints of wet rock/minerality. Medium to full-bodied, with stunning concentration, texture, and length, this is a profound Chardonnay to drink over the next 5-7 years, possibly longer. 90 Points Wine Spectator: "Elegant and graceful, with subtle pear, fig, white peach and nectarine notes that are slow to gain depth. Maintains elegance and finesse. Drink now through 2019. 211 cases made."
